Napoleon ordered the Arc de Triomphe built in 1806 to honor his Grand Army after the victory at Austerlitz, promising his soldiers they would march home beneath a triumphal arch. Designed by Jean-François-Thérèse Chalgrin after Rome's Arch of Titus, construction dragged through Napoleon's fall from power and was not completed until 1836, under the July Monarchy. Standing 164 feet tall at the head of the Champs-Élysées, it has crowned the Paris skyline as one of France's most recognizable monuments ever since.
